1970's. In the 1970s, many are not wealthy and many families lined frugally. The trees next to the Queenstown library are the playground for many children who climbed onto trees, run on the gentle slopes of Margaret Drive and played marbles on the red soil along side Margaret Drive. The sounds of the Malay satay man at 4pm and the sweet shops at the shop houses resonates in my mind as if it was yesterday..... (Memory collected at the Queenstown Public Library during "The Singapore Story: My Heart, My Hope, My home" campaign from 6 Sep to 31 Dec 2012)
